  8. RudeDude

    Gen 3 Charger Power Sharing - who has this working?

    When setting up the master / slave TWC and the shared circuit limit I believe I could have entered any integer for circuit total amp limit. I entered 48 (60 amp breaker, 80%). Therefore the two TWC's with two cars plugged in will self limit to 24A each if both cars are trying to pull max. Yes...
